Uncovering the History of the Springer Spaniel: A Pet Lover's Guide

Young man relaxing with a Springer Spaniel in a cozy living room, history of Springer Spaniel.

The Endearing History of the Springer Spaniel

The Springer Spaniel has captured the hearts of pet lovers worldwide with its playful demeanor and friendly nature. These dogs, originally bred in England to flush game from cover, have evolved into beloved family pets and companions. The history of the Springer Spaniel is steeped in rich tradition and working lineage, making them not just pets but also loyal partners in various activities.

In THE HISTORY OF THE SPRINGER SPANIEL, we explore the breed's captivating past, shedding light on its evolution and significance as a beloved family pet.

A Dog of Noble Heritage

Springer Spaniels belong to a family of gundogs known for their keen sense of smell and superior agility. Their lineage can be traced back to the 19th century, where they were bred for hunting and retrieving. The breed’s evolution led to two distinct varieties: the English Springer Spaniel and the American Springer Spaniel. While both share common ancestry, they have diverged in appearance and temperament. The English type is slightly larger and is more frequently used in field trials, while the American variant is often bred for its aesthetics.

The Friendly Family Companion

Today, the Springer Spaniel is known not only for its talents in the field but also for its affectionate temperament. They thrive in family environments, often forming strong bonds with children and other pets. Their playful nature and intelligence mean they adapt well to various living situations, from urban apartments to sprawling country homes. This adaptability makes them an excellent choice for dog owners looking for a loving and energetic companion.

Training Tips for New Dog Parents

For new pet parents, training a Springer Spaniel can be a rewarding experience. These dogs are eager to please, which works in favor of trainers. Positive reinforcement methods are encouraged, as Springer Spaniels respond best to rewards-based training. Consistency, patience, and engagement are key components for effective learning. Regular exercise is essential, not only to channel their high energy but also to maintain their mental health.

Keeping Their Spirits High

Springers are known to thrive on human interaction and need daily activities for mental stimulation. Incorporating fun games like fetch or agility training can ensure that they remain healthy and happy. Additionally, socializing them from a young age can help mitigate behavioral issues down the line, creating a well-rounded dog.
